Tesla electric cars will soon receive the "guard mode"



[ad_1]

Tesla owners will soon be able to observe (and record) the damage caused by their transport while it remains unattended. Tesla introduces Tesla sentinel mode, Tesla surveillance mode for all cars equipped with improved autopilot.

Ilon Mask said on Twitter about this.

Mask did not reveal any additional information about when this feature would be available. and as it works specifically.

As its name indicates, the function "will remain" as it were, either by supporting the on-board DVR in the car park, or by automatically including it if the car is in contact with something or something striking. Most likely, it will work as a classic video recorder with the ability to automatically activate the impact.

In October, Tesla released version 9.0 of its software, which included several updates, including a new user interface on the center display and the ability to use the built-in camera at the front of the car. as a DVR. The DVR feature is only available on Tesla cars marketed after August 2017.

Currently, the DVR feature allows owners to record and store videos captured by the camera at the front of the car on the flash USB . But the first owners have to configure the flash drive under Windows or MS- DOS and add a folder at the base called TeslaCam. Then the configured USB flash drive can be inserted into any of the USB ports located at the front of the car. When properly configured, the DVR icon will appear in the status of the red line, indicating that the recording is in progress.

Owners can click on the icon to save the 10-minute video clip or block it and pause the recording. The downloaded entries are automatically deleted.
